#417741 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#417741 is composed of 25.5% red, 46.7% green and 25.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 45.4% cyan, 0% magenta, 45.4% yellow and 53.3% black. It has a hue angle of 120 degrees, a saturation of 29.3% and a lightness of 36.1%. #417741 color hex could be obtained by blending #82ee82 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#336633.

#417741 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#417741 has RGB values of R:65, G:119, B:65 and CMYK values of C:0.45, M:0, Y:0.45, K:0.53. Its decimal value is 4290369.
